CHAPTER VIII: WORSHIP OF THE SELF
 
1. If you separate yourself from the body
and abide at ease in Consciousness you will
become one (the sole Reality), everything
else appearing (insignificant) like grass.
 
2. After knowing that by which you know
this (world) turn the mind inward and then
you will see clearly (realize) the effulgence of
the Self.
 
3. O Raghava, that by which you recognize
sound, taste, form and smell know that as
your Self, the Supreme Brahman, the Lord of
lords.
 
4. O Raghava, that in which beings vibrate,
that which creates them, know that Self
to be your real Self.
 
5. After rejecting, through reasoning, all
that can be known as 'non-truth' what remains
as pure Consciousness — regard as your real
Self.
 
6. Knowledge is not separate from you
and that which is known is not separate from
knowledge. Hence there is nothing other than
the Self, nothing separate (from it).
 
7. 'All that Brahma, Vishnu, Siva, Indra
and others always do is done by me the
embodiment of Consciousness' — think in this
manner.
 
8. 'I am the whole universe. I am the
undecaying Supreme Self. There is neither
past nor future apart from me' — reflect in
this manner.
 
9. 'Everything is the One Brahman, pure
Consciousness, the Self of all, indivisible and
immutable' — reflect in this manner.
 
10. 'There is neither I nor any other
thing. Only Brahman exists always full of
bliss everywhere.' Meditate on this calmly.
 
11. The sense of perceiver and perceived
is common to all embodied beings, but the
Yogi worships the One Self.
